Description For Software Development Engineer (Prime Video Live Events), Live Events Availability

Amazon Prime Video is seeking a talented Software Development Engineer to join their Live Events team, focusing on revolutionizing how live video content is delivered to millions of customers worldwide. This role sits at the intersection of cutting-edge technology and entertainment, working with Amazon's massive video streaming infrastructure.

The position offers an exciting opportunity to work on large-scale, high-performance systems that power Prime Video's live event streaming capabilities across 250+ countries and territories. You'll be part of a team that's disrupting traditional television and movie industry through innovative technology solutions and reliable digital delivery.

As a Software Engineer in this role, you'll be responsible for designing and implementing multi-tier services that handle large datasets and complex domains at Amazon's impressive scale. The role requires expertise in object-oriented design, particularly with Java/C++, and familiarity with web services, XML, JSON, and Apache services. Experience with Linux system development is valued.

Responsibilities For Software Development Engineer (Prime Video Live Events), Live Events Availability

  • Build platform for delivering live video events to customers
  • Design multi-tier services to handle large datasets
  • Create reliable and maintainable code
  • Develop solutions for problems at Amazon scale
  • Work with high-performance, customer-friendly products
  • Adapt to new development environments and changing business requirements

Requirements For Software Development Engineer (Prime Video Live Events), Live Events Availability

Java
Linux
  • 3+ years of non-internship professional software development experience
  • 2+ years of non-internship design or architecture experience
  • Experience programming with at least one software programming language
  • Strong background in OO design with Java/C++
  • Experience with web services, XML, JSON, Apache services (desired)
  • Linux system development experience (plus)
